Psalm 80

NKJV

HNV

1 To the Chief Musician. Set to 'The Lilies.' A Testimony of Asaph. A Psalm. Give ear, O Shepherd of Israel, You who lead Joseph like a flock; You who dwell between the cherubim, shine forth!
1 <<For the Chief Musician. To the tune "The Lilies of the Covenant." A Psalm by Asaf.>> Hear us, Shepherd of Yisra'el, You who lead Yosef like a flock, You who sit above the Keruvim, shine forth.
2 Before Ephraim, Benjamin, and Manasseh, Stir up Your strength, And come and save us!
2 Before Efrayim and Binyamin and Menashsheh, stir up your might, Come to save us.
3 Restore us, O God; Cause Your face to shine, And we shall be saved!
3 Turn us again, God. Cause your face to shine, And we will be saved.
4 O Lord God of hosts, How long will You be angry Against the prayer of Your people?
4 LORD God Tzva'ot, How long will you be angry against the prayer of your people?
5 You have fed them with the bread of tears, And given them tears to drink in great measure.
5 You have fed them with the bread of tears, And given them tears to drink in large measure.
6 You have made us a strife to our neighbors, And our enemies laugh among themselves.
6 You make us a source of contention to our neighbors. Our enemies laugh among themselves.
7 Restore us, O God of hosts; Cause Your face to shine, And we shall be saved!
7 Turn us again, God Tzva'ot. Cause your face to shine, And we will be saved.
8 You have brought a vine out of Egypt; You have cast out the nations, and planted it.
8 You brought a vine out of Mitzrayim. You drove out the nations, and planted it.
9 You prepared room for it, And caused it to take deep root, And it filled the land.
9 You cleared the ground for it. It took deep root, and filled the land.
10 The hills were covered with its shadow, And the mighty cedars with its boughs.
10 The mountains were covered with its shadow. Its boughs were like God's cedars.
11 She sent out her boughs to the Sea, And her branches to the River.
11 It sent out its branches to the sea, Its shoots to the River.
12 Why have You broken down her hedges, So that all who pass by the way pluck her fruit?
12 Why have you broken down its walls, So that all those who pass by the way pluck it?
13 The boar out of the woods uproots it, And the wild beast of the field devours it.
13 The boar out of the wood ravages it. The wild animals of the field feed on it.
14 Return, we beseech You, O God of hosts; Look down from heaven and see, And visit this vine
14 Turn again, we beg you, God Tzva'ot. Look down from heaven, and see, and visit this vine,
15 And the vineyard which Your right hand has planted, And the branch that You made strong for Yourself.
15 The stock which your right hand planted, The branch that you made strong for yourself.
16 It is burned with fire, it is cut down; They perish at the rebuke of Your countenance.
16 It is burned with fire. It is cut down. They perish at your rebuke.
17 Let Your hand be upon the man of Your right hand, Upon the son of man whom You made strong for Yourself.
17 Let your hand be on the man of your right hand, On the son of man whom you made strong for yourself.
18 Then we will not turn back from You; Revive us, and we will call upon Your name.
18 So we will not turn away from you. Revive us, and we will call on your name.
19 Restore us, O Lord God of hosts; Cause Your face to shine, And we shall be saved!
19 Turn us again, LORD God Tzva'ot. Cause your face to shine, and we will be saved.
